Description

When you’re rebuilding a chain on your elevator, conveyor, or hay equipment and need to adjust the length just right, this offset half link is exactly what you need. That extra half pitch lets you get the chain tension perfect without having to remove full links or deal with a chain that’s too loose or too tight. Nothing’s more frustrating than getting everything back together only to find your chain won’t run smooth because the length isn’t quite right.

What You’re Getting

  • Heavy-duty carbon steel construction that handles the constant stress of agricultural applications
  • Precision 3/4-inch pitch that matches standard #60 chain perfectly
  • Extra-thick heavy plate design provides longer service life in demanding farm conditions
  • Single-strand design works with most common agricultural drive systems
  • Offset configuration allows easy length adjustment during chain repair or installation

Good to Know

Keep a few of these on hand – they’re handy for fine-tuning chain length when you’re doing maintenance or repairs. Make sure to properly lubricate the chain after installation, and check that your offset link is oriented the same direction as the other links. A quick tip: when you’re shortening a chain, save the links you remove – they might come in handy later for another repair.
